In July, 2015, just days before her wedding, Abby Sanders came home early from shopping for a wedding dress and found her fiancé in bed with a co-worker. Distraught, she visits her grandmother in Laramie, Wyoming Caught in a time warp, she is transported to 1867 where she meets Thomas Barnes who wants to get married… to Abby. Can she get past her heartbreak and find love with Thomas on the Wyoming frontier? Can he face the fact she may return to her own time? *** Rated PG. The content herein contains no profanity, and one scene with violence. There is one non-descriptive sexual scene in the prologue; no more other than three chaste kisses. Heat level of 1 on the low to high scale of 1-5.
Susan Leigh Carlton lives near Tomball, Texas, a suburb twenty-six miles northwest of Houston. She began writing and publishing on Amazon in August 2012. Susan observed the eighty-seventh anniversary of her birth on April 17th, 2021. She says, “I quit having birthdays because they are so depressing. Now, I have anniversaries of my birth.” Susan and her husband celebrated their fifty-fifth wedding anniversary on April 16th, 2021, the day before her eighty-seventh birthday. She said, “One of the many pleasures I get from writing, is the email I receive from readers that have read and liked my books. I even like the letters that are critical of the writing, because it means the writer cared enough to take the time to write.
Romance in Time by Susan Leigh Carlton A Western Time Travel Romance
Susan writes a unique Western Romance. It starts out in modern times with her fiancé having an affair as Abby catches him in the act. Abby goes to visit her Grandparents in Wyoming to get away from the embarrassment. As the story unfolds, she travels back in time by a freak storm. Abby is discovered by a wagon train outside of the area her Grandparents live in. This sweet romance takes a modern woman and forces her to discover the Old West first hand. Will she find love in the Old West or miss her life in 2015? Can she travel back to her own time or will she be stuck in the Old West forever? I recommend this book to those who love Western Romance, Mail Order Brides, Clean Romance, and Time Travel.
